Multi-signature workflow support (#3264)
- New keys add --multisig flag to store multisig keys locally. - New multisign command to generate multisig signatures. - New sign --multisig flag to enable multisig mode. - Add multisig transactions support in ante handler. - gaiad add-genesis-account can now take both account addresses and key names.
